Horne baronets


The Horne Baronetcy, of Shackleford in the County of Surrey, is a title in the Baronetage of the United Kingdom. It was created on 25 March 1929 for [Sir Sir Edgar Horne, 1st Baronet|Edgar Horne, 1st Baronet|Edgar Horne]. He was Chairman of the Prudential Assurance Company and also represented Guildford in the House of Commons as a Unionist.
